2014 DD dad here, I would think Arlington offers the most sought after team and likely the hardest to get on as they have 5 teams and an ECNL pathway. I have heard Arlington has been swamped with kids at tryouts. So, that bodes well for them.

After Arlington, I'd rank Bethesda, then McLean.

Although tryouts are practically over, you can just contact the club and attend a practice. Depending on the club, just contact the coaches and you will likely be directed to a 2nd team practice and then seek the coaches feedback and go from there. Kids have been coming out to our 2nd team and they have directed them up or down a level as needed for the next practice.
